Qatar denies allegations of funding Hamas in Gaza

Qatar has issued a categorical rejection of reports in Israeli media alleging that the country has provided funds to Hamas. The Qatar International Media Office stated that such claims are entirely baseless and represent attempts to distort Qatar's role in providing humanitarian assistance to the Palestinian people in the Gaza Strip.

According to the official statement, Qatari aid—which includes food, medicine, fuel, and electricity—is specifically targeted toward the most vulnerable families in Gaza. The office emphasized that all financial and material aid has been distributed through transparent mechanisms in full coordination with the United Nations and Israeli authorities.

Qatar clarified that all aid previously passed through Israel before entering Gaza and was conducted with the knowledge and approval of successive Israeli governments and security agencies. The statement further noted that any funds reaching Hamas outside of these established, documented mechanisms have no connection to Qatar or its humanitarian efforts.
